In May 1982, a thousand Argentine soldiers sat in their trenches at Goose Green, completely convinced the British would never actually attack. Their officers told them diplomacy would end it. The math said an assault was suicide. Even the BBC announced the British were coming and they still didn't believe it. Hours later, 600 paratroopers from 2 PARA launched a brutal night assault that would change the entire Falklands War. This is the story of what happened when an outnumbered battalion attacked a fortified garrison across open ground and what the Argentine conscripts said when they realized no one was coming to negotiate.
Lt. Col. H. Jones led from the front and paid with his life. Major Chris Keeble took command and pulled off one of the boldest bluffs in modern military history. And nearly a thousand young Argentine soldiers many of them teenagers surrendered with the same words on their lips: "We thought they would negotiate."
This is the Battle of Goose Green. The fight nobody believed would happen.
